4. Choosing Your Difficulty – Quick Wins vs Big Jumps

You can tune the risk level by picking one of four difficulty settings: Easy (24 steps), Medium (22), Hard (20), and Hardcore (15). Each level adjusts the probability of hitting a trap and thus changes the pace of potential payouts.

  • Easy: Lower risk, more frequent small wins.
  • Medium: Balance between risk and reward.
  • Hard: Higher chance of traps but larger potential multipliers.
  • Hardcore: Shortest path, highest volatility.
